Understanding the New Weapon Customization System
The Helldivers 2 New Weapon Customization System allows players to modify their arsenal in unprecedented ways. Unlike the previous iteration, where weapons had fixed stats and attachments, the new system emphasizes flexibility. Players can now adjust recoil patterns, fire rates, ammo types, and even aesthetic components without breaking the balance of multiplayer gameplay.

From my experience, the most significant improvement is the ability to experiment with loadouts that cater to different mission types. For example, high-mobility strike missions benefit from lighter weapons with faster fire rates, while defensive setups excel when players optimize for suppressive fire and area control.

Practical Tips for Players

  1. Start Small: Don’t rush into fully customizing every weapon. Begin by testing minor stat changes and attachments to understand how they affect handling in live missions.

  2. Match Loadouts to Team Composition: Communication is key in Helldivers. Ensure that your weapon choices complement your squadmates’ roles. A well-balanced team can handle tougher missions more efficiently.

  3. Experiment with Ammo Types: The Helldivers 2 New Weapon Customization System offers alternative ammo options that can turn a standard weapon into a specialized tool. Shock rounds, incendiary ammo, and armor-piercing options all have strategic uses depending on the enemies you face.
